August 16, 2016– Project Freight Net B.V. has announced the addition of Tandem Logistics (Algeria) as the new member for Algeria to its Project Freight Forwarders network.
Tandem Logistics (Algeria) is a private independent project forwarding company and a leading specialist in providing project transportation solutions and total logistics management of project related cargoes.

Tandem operates Algeria from their Center of Excellence in Tunisia which gives them more flexibility and are less constrained by local Algerian obstacles and restrictions.
